RangeMe sourcing platform launches in UK

Sourcing platform RangeMe has launched in the UK. It offers retailers instant access to over 200,000 suppliers and more than 750,000 products from around the world, with beauty being one of its big categories.


RangeMe



High street chain LloydsPharmacy is already using it in Britain and the US-based company said the world’s largest product discovery platform can transform the sourcing process for other retailers too. 

RangeMe launched in 2013 and is used today by over 12,000 retailers in the US, including Walmart, Ulta Beauty, Walgreens, and Albertsons. 

It says it “helps retailers and their buying teams scale product sourcing efforts with streamlined submissions, simplified discovery tools, and the industry standard digital sell sheet”. It lets buyers filter searches "to find brands meeting exact sourcing needs, enables seamless connectivity and collaboration with suppliers and provides curated collections to help identify and understand category trends and emerging brands”.

CEO Nicky Jackson said: “Consumers are looking for a variety of products from all over the world and sourcing them online. The British public is no different, yet high street retailers have struggled to offer these products in store or online principally because they don’t have sight of all that’s available in the market. RangeMe will change this, bringing more choice to shopping aisles and a significant revenue opportunity. We will pick up the heavy lifting for buyers and present the global product market opportunity in one screen”.   

The company said it’s also inviting British suppliers to join the platform “for a front-row audience of the biggest high street retailers”.
